Spicy Chipotle Tomato Sauce

Serves 1 (generous serving)

Large handful of cherry tomatoes or about 2 large tomatoes

3 delicious sun dried tomatoes
Generous pinch of himalayan salt
Generous dash of smoked paprika

Generous dash of chipotle powder (I use Frontier brand)

1/2 small knob of garlic
1/4 large red capsicum (red pepper)

Throw all your ingredients into a blender and blend till smooth.I love to give mine a good kick of spice so I am quite heavy-handed with the chipotle.Pour straight over your pasta of choice. To keep it raw I use zucchini noodles or you could use kelp noodles.This would be lovely over cooked gluten-free pasta. also. and don’t forget to throw in additional flavours like olives or basil if you fancy. I have just been enjoying it as is or with a dollop of my cashew cheese on top.

Its summer over here in Australia so it’s a perfect meal in the heat. If you want it warm you can heat the sauce on the stove or warm in your dehydrator if you have one.
